Programming in objective book

All books about object oriented programming are good books. In particular this is not a book on using cocoa or on developing ios applications and there are lots of other books that deal with this side of the programming task. Programming in objectivec is a concise, carefully written tutorial on the basics of. Next supplies its own compiler for the objectivec language a modi. Which is the best book for object oriented programming.

Pdf programming in objective c download full pdf book. The book is intended for readers who might be interested in. The book makes no assumption about prior experience with objectoriented programming languages or with the c language upon which objective c is based. Although there is a chapter each on the cocoa framework and iphone development, this book is focused on the objective c language and apples foundation framework. Audience this reference has been prepared for the beginners to help them understand basic to advanced concepts related to objective c programming languages. Objectivec is the primary programming language you use when writing software for os x and ios. The objective of this book is to teach the skills necessary to program in objective c using a style that is easy to follow, rich in examples and accessible to those who have never used objective c before. Mar 24, 2006 objectoriented programming with objective c march 24, 2006 this pdfonline book is intended for readers who might be interested in. This book does not assume that the reader has any previous knowledge of any objectoriented programming language. Chapter 1 introduction this book is an introduction to ml programming, speci. Cox received his bachelor of science degree in organic chemistry and mathematics from furman. Other resources will have to be utilized to learn cocoa or cocoa touch.

Programming in objectivec, fifth edition updated for os x mountain lion, ios 6, and xcode 4. Download free lectures notes, papers and ebooks related to programming, computer science, web design, mobile app development, software engineering, networking, databases, information technology and many more. The objectivec not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ow. This is a really nice overview of objectivec programming, and i also appreciated the format. The book makes no assumptions about prior experience with objectoriented programming languages or with the c language which objective. Objectivec programming for dummies cheat sheet dummies. Best computer coding books for beginners and experts in. This book was and the previous edition a great way to clear that hurdle. Good resourcebook for learning objectivec stack overflow. This book is intended for programmers, undergraduate and beginning graduate students with some experience programming in a procedural programming language like c or java, or in some other functional programming language. The design space of objectbased languages is characterized in terms of objects, classes, inheritance, data abstraction, strong typing, concurrency, and persistence. The objectivec language 2 programming in objectivec 7 compiling and running programs 7 using xcode 8 using terminal 16 explanation of your first program 18 displaying the values of variables 22 summary 25 exercises 25. Objectivec inherits the syntax, primitive types, and flow control statements of c and adds syntax for defining classes and methods.

C programming mcq multiple choice question and answer c programming mcq with detailed explanation for interview, entrance and competitive exams. Programming in objectivec, 6th edition hd pdf appnee. Objectivec programming wikibooks, open books for an open world. See credits at the end of this book whom contributed to the various chapters. Objective c is a generalpurpose, objectoriented programming language that adds smalltalkstyle messaging to the c programming language. Programming in objective c is a concise, carefully written tutorial on the basics of objective c and objectoriented programming for the ios and mac platforms. Learning about objectoriented programming, finding out about the basis for the cocoa application framework and programming in objective c. Programming in objectivec is a concise, carefully written tutorial on the basics of objectivec and objectoriented programming. Other books are more comprehensive, and deal w the gui interface integration, and they are important. The book makes no assumptions about prior experience with objectoriented programming languages or with the c language which objectivec is based upon. It fully documents the objectivec language, an objectoriented programming language based on standard c, and provides a foundation for learning about mac os xs objectivec application development frameworkcocoa. Programming in objective c, fifth edition updated for os x mountain lion, ios 6, and xcode 4.

Programming in objec tivec is a concise, carefully written tutorial on the basics of objective c and objectoriented programming for apples ios and os x platforms. There is never anything that is the best of anything. It was named after the concept of adding objects to the c language if you have programmed before and would like to see a little bit of how objective c works and is different from other programming languages, you can get an overview. Through a lot of detailed examples and wellcrafted exercises, programming in objectivec systematically introduces objectivec languages basic concepts. Learning about objectoriented programming, finding out about the openstep development environment, or programming in objectivec. This chapter discusses origins of soviet multiobjective programming. Programming in objec tivec, fifth edition updated for os x mountain lion, ios 6, and xcode 4. This is the only introductorylevel book written by aaron hillegass, one of the most experienced and authoritative voices in the ios and cocoa community. Neal goldstein is a veteran programmer and trusted instructor of ios programming topics. The book makes no assumptions about prior experience with objectoriented programming languages or with the c language which.

Author information neal goldstein is a veteran programmer and trusted instructor of ios programming topics. Programming in objectivec is a concise, carefully written tutorial on the basics of objectivec and objectoriented programming for the ios and mac platforms. Sep 17, 2014 objectivec is the primary programming language you use when writing software for os x and ios. The goal of this book is to teach the skills necessary to program in objectivec using a style that is easy to follow, rich in examples and accessible to those who. Assuming no prior programming language experience, this funandfriendly book provides you with a solid understanding of objective c. The book does not assume previous experience with either c or objectoriented programming. What you will learn from this book 2 how this book is organized 3 support 5 acknowledgments 5 preface to the fifth edition 6 i. Programming in objectivec is a concise and meticulous bestseller in the field of objectivec programming, which covers the latest information on xcode, mac os x mavericks, and ios. As long as you dont expect this book to be an introduction to ios or cocoa programming then it is a very good introduction to the objective c language recommended. C programming objective type questions pdf download. This book concisely explains the best practices for programming for ios and os x with objective c. Programming in objectivec is a concise, carefully written tutorial on the basics of objectivec and objectoriented programming for apples ios and os x. The best book on any programming language that i,ve ever read.

It was named after the concept of adding objects to the c language if you have programmed before and would like to see a little bit of how objectivec works and is different from other programming languages, you can get an overview objective c was introduced with nextstep and openstep, and was considerably extended in. What i used to begin learning objectivec and ios development are the books. Ocaml is a dialect of the ml metalanguage family of languages, which derive from the classic ml language designed by robin milner in 1975 for the lcf logic of computable functions theorem. Objective c is an objectoriented programming language.

Stephen kochan is the author and coauthor of several bestselling titles on the c language, including programming in c sams, 2004, programming in ansi c sams, 1994, and topics in c programming wiley, 1991, as well as several unix titles, including exploring the unix system sams, 1992 and unix shell programming sams 2003. Buy a cheap copy of programming in objective c book by stephen g. Objectivec programming for dummies is the ideal beginner book if your objective is to venture into iphone, ipad, and mac os x development for the first time. It was the main programming language supported by apple for macos, ios, and their respective application programming interfaces apis, cocoa and cocoa touch, until the introduction of swift in 2014. Pdf objective c programming download full pdf book. Objective c programming for dummies is the ideal beginner book if your objective is to venture into iphone, ipad, and mac os x development for the first time. In the soviet union, multiobjective programming is a relatively new area of research, emerging only in the 1960s and 1970s as a separate subfield of soviet operations research, systems analysis, and what is called cybernetics in the ussr. Calvin wolcott an excellent resource for a new programmer who wants to learn objectivec as their first programming languagea woefully underserved market. Buy programming in objective c developers library 6 by kochan, stephen isbn. Getting started with objectivec language, basic data types, enums, structs, classes and objects, inheritance, methods, properties, random integer, bool. This book rd sharma objective mathematics pdf is going to be highly useful for various competitive exams like ibps po, ibps clerk, sbi po, sbi clerk, rbi grade b, ssc graduate level exams, bank po and clerk, nda, cds, railway, rrb, ssc, bank, sbi, ibps, ssc cgl and other competitive exams, tgt and pgt exam, mba, hotel management, airforce, nda, navy, cds, ssc or ssc cgl or. Objectivec is a generalpurpose, objectoriented programming language that adds smalltalkstyle messaging to the c programming language. Programming in objective c is a concise, carefully written tutorial on the basics of objective c and objectoriented programming. Programming in c will teach you how to write programs in the c programming language.

Programming in objectivec is a relatively concise, carefully written tutorial on the basics of objectivec and objectoriented programming for apples ios and mac platforms. Pat hughes table of contents 1 introduction 2 programming in objectivec 3. Programming in objective c is a concise, carefully written tutorial on the basics of objective c and objectoriented programming for apples ios and os x platforms. Audience this reference has been prepared for the beginners to help them understand basic to advanced concepts related to objectivec programming languages. Objectivec is an objectoriented programming language. The objective of this book is to teach the skills necessary to program in objectivec using a style that is easy to follow, rich in examples and accessible to those who have never used objectivec before. Objectoriented programming with objectivec march 24, 2006 this pdfonline book is intended for readers who might be interested in. Buy a cheap copy of programming in objectivec book by stephen g. The objective c not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ow. This is a really nice overview of objective c programming, and i also appreciated the format. Dec 07, 1999 programming in objective c is a concise, carefully written tutorial on the basics of objective c and objectoriented programming. Objectivec programming wikibooks, open books for an. Best computer coding books for beginners and experts in 2020. The book makes no assumptions about prior experience with objectoriented programming languages or with the c.

Objectivec programming for dummies by neal goldstein. This is the place to start learning to program for osx. Following quizzes provides multiple choice questions mcqs related to c programming. Programming in objective c is a concise, carefully written tutorial on the basics of objective c and objectoriented programming for apples ios and mac platforms. Download objective type questions of c programming pdf visit our pdf store. Brad cox is a computer scientist known mostly for creating the objectivec programming language with his business partner tom love and for his work in software engineering specifically software reuse and software componentry. What you will learn from this book 2 how this book is organized 3 support 5 acknowledgments 5 preface to the sixth edition 6 i. Because of this, both beginners and experienced programmers alike. Objectivec comes with a number of builtin data types, as well as mechanisms to create new ones, for programming your ios or mac os x applications. Programming in objectivec, sixth edition book oreilly. Kochan, 9780321967602, available at book depository with free delivery worldwide.

Based on big nerd ranchs legendary objectivec bootcamp, this book covers c, objectivec, and the common programming idioms that enable developers to make the most of apple technologies. This is the 4th edition of the worlds bestselling book on objectivec programming, fully updated to cover xcode 4. Everyday low prices and free delivery on eligible orders. The variables you declare in objectivec objectivec data types must be a type that the compiler can recognize. Assuming no prior programming language experience, this funandfriendly book provides you with a solid understanding of objectivec. Prerequisites before you start doing practice with various types of examples given in this. Learning about objectoriented programming, finding out about the basis for the cocoa application framework and programming in objectivec. Based on big nerd ranchs legendary objective c bootcamp, this book covers c, objective c, and the common programming idioms that enable developers to make the most of apple technologies.

Because of this, both beginners and experienced programmers alike can use this. Best books for learning objectivec programming according to the hacker news community. Programming in objectivec is a concise, carefully wri. Text content is released under creative commons bysa.

Its a superset of the c programming language and provides objectoriented capabilities and a dynamic runtime. Best books for learning objectivec programming hacker news. The book makes no assumption about prior experience with objectoriented programming languages or with the c language upon which objectivec is based. Although there is a chapter each on the cocoa framework and iphone development, this book is focused on the objectivec language and apples foundation framework. The book makes no assumptions about prior experience with objectoriented programming languages or with the c language which objective c is based upon. Apr 16, 2020 swift objective c programming in objective c. Multiobjective programming in the ussr sciencedirect. The objective c language 2 programming in objective c 7 compiling and running programs 7 using xcode 8 using terminal 16 explanation of your first program 18 displaying the values of variables 22 summary 25 exercises 25. What is the best objective question book for c from a. This book is also designed to help you become familiar with objectoriented. The objectivec programming language free computer books. Addressing the latest version of xcode, debugging, code completion, and more, veteran author neal goldstein helps you gain a solid foundation of this complex topic, and filters out any unnecessary intricate. It was the main programming language supported by apple for macos, ios, and their respective application programming interfaces apis, cocoa and cocoa touch, until the introduction of swift in 2014 the language was originally developed in the early 1980s. Programming in objec tivec is a concise, carefully written tutorial on the basics of objective c and objectoriented programming.

334 1262 780 924 94 1042 948 633 593 594 137 327 456 1605 192 1079 75 1043 35 1640 77 1040 1585 59 95 337 1311 1529 1063 433 532 490 872 1221 1272 872